#bd6184 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#bd6184 is composed of 74.1% red, 38% green and 51.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48.7% magenta, 30.2% yellow and 25.9% black. It has a hue angle of 337.2 degrees, a saturation of 41.1% and a lightness of 56.1%. #bd6184 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c2ff with #7b0009.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

Shades and Tints of #bd6184

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080305 is the darkest color, while #fdf9fa is the lightest one.
